Charleroi has had a turbulent season and is now looking for a new coach. After Rik De Mil's departure to AA Gent and the brief tenure of assistant Hans Cornelis, who was fired in April after a streak of ten winless matches, the club at Mambourg is busy finding a successor. Preparation for the new season is just around the corner, and a decision needs to be made quickly. According to transfer watcher Sacha Tavolieri, Mario Kohnen, who previously served as an assistant, is the frontrunner for the head coach position. Kohnen, who started as an assistant at Charleroi in 2025, has no prior experience as a head coach but impressed during the playoffs after Cornelis's dismissal, achieving a strong 17 out of 27 points. This week, final discussions are expected to take place, and it seems Kohnen will soon sign his contract. Charleroi hopes this choice will lead to a fresh start for the upcoming season.
